The street in brief

Tibshelf Road is a mix of detached houses and semi-detached houses. The median sale price is £177,800, about 9% above the typical NG17 sale.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; NG17 prices as a whole have held broadly level. With 10 sales across 7 homes since 2002, homes here come to market only rarely.
